Steven Universe: Save The Light trip report.

First time I booted it and selected a save file to use, it loaded to a black screen. After waiting about three minutes, and remembering hearing other games doing something similar, I rebooted the Switch and tried again. This time the intro video loaded immediately.

Overall the game is... pretty good. Framerate isn't great. Aims for 30, gets it most of the time. There's noticable slowdown in battles but it might be intentional?

Gameplay itself is okay. The first (mobile only) game was a turn-based Paper Mario affair, with extra damage or effects applied if you mash again at the right time. STL's combat is similar, but adds a FF style active combat--which I've never really been a fan of, to be honest (what can I say, I like taking turns).

If you like Steven Universe, there's a lot to like about the game, and the potential for character and team build customization seems promising (I'm building Amethyst to be a area attack crit machine). If you're not a fan of the show, though, you won't miss much if you don't pick up the game.
